    "body": "Skill Health Monitor\n\nCatch skill degradation before it becomes a crisis. Monitors response times, error rates, output drift, and resource usage for deployed skills.\n\nWhy This Exists\n\nSkills work fine during testing, then silently degrade in production. Free models change behavior, APIs add latency, memory leaks accumulate. By the time you notice, your agent has been running on broken skills for hours.\n\nCommands\nMonitor a skill execution\npython3 {baseDir}/scripts/health_monitor.py check --skill <name> --cmd \"python3 path/to/script.py\"\n\nView health dashboard\npython3 {baseDir}/scripts/health_monitor.py dashboard\n\nSet alert thresholds\npython3 {baseDir}/scripts/health_monitor.py threshold --skill <name> --max-latency 5000 --max-errors 3\n\nExport health report\npython3 {baseDir}/scripts/health_monitor.py report --json\n\nView trends for a skill\npython3 {baseDir}/scripts/health_monitor.py trend --skill <name> --period 24h\n\nWhat It Tracks\nLatency: Execution time per invocation, p50/p95/p99 percentiles\nError rate: Failed executions, error types, frequency\nOutput drift: Detects when output format or content changes unexpectedly\nResource usage: Memory and CPU at execution time\nUptime: Availability over time windows (1h, 24h, 7d)\nAlerting\nConsole alerts when thresholds are exceeded\nJSON webhook support for external integrations\nConfigurable per-skill thresholds\nData Storage\n\nHealth data is stored in ~/.openclaw/health/ as JSON files. One file per skill, rotated daily."
